Michelin starred chef to open new restaurant at £250m redevelopment project in Belfast
The Michelin starred chef is to open his “first and only restaurant on the island of Ireland” which will form part of the new £25 million Marriott Hotel.
The four-star AC Hotel by Marriott Belfast is the city’s newest waterfront hotel development which will feature the landmark 104-seat restaurant, as well as bar, lounge, gym, meeting rooms and almost 190 luxury bedrooms.

Hide AdThe restaurant is expected to open along with the hotel in early 2018 and will be called ‘Jean-Christophe Novelli at City Quays’.
Graeme Johnston, property director of Belfast Harbour, said the restaurant represented a coup for the city.
“Recognised across the UK, Ireland, Europe and beyond, Jean-Christophe Novelli is a true champion of high quality, down-to-earth and innovative menu combinations and his decision to choose City Quays, and Belfast, is a testament to the success of our development plans for this key city centre site and the strong demand for great hospitality and the vibrancy of our visitor economy,” he said.
